Frequently Asked Questions

How do I find the right oil filters for my Volkswagen Jetta?

Verify compatibility using your Volkswagen Jetta's VIN number, production year (2019-2024), and engine code. Check seller compatibility charts and cross-reference OEM part numbers when possible.

Should I use OEM or aftermarket oil filters for my Volkswagen Jetta?

OEM parts guarantee exact Volkswagen specifications and fitment. Quality aftermarket brands often meet or exceed OEM standards at lower prices. For warranty vehicles, check if aftermarket parts affect coverage.

How often should I replace oil filters on my Volkswagen Jetta?

General guideline: Replace with every oil change (5,000-10,000 miles). However, driving conditions (city vs highway, climate, towing) affect replacement frequency. Inspect regularly and replace when warning signs appear.
